package model import ( "context" "gorm.io/gorm" "gorm.io/gorm/schema" "reflect" ) type UploadingFile struct { gorm.Model Filename string Description string TargetResourceID uint TargetStorageID uint UserID uint BlockSize int64 TotalSize int64 Blocks UploadingFileBlocks `gorm:"type:blob"` TempPath string Resource Resource `gorm:"foreignKey:TargetResourceID"` Storage Storage `gorm:"foreignKey:TargetStorageID"` } func (uf *UploadingFile) BlocksCount() int { return int((uf.TotalSize + uf.BlockSize - 1) / uf.BlockSize) } type UploadingFileBlocks []bool func (ufb *UploadingFileBlocks) Scan(ctx context.Context, field *schema.Field, dst reflect.Value, dbValue interface{}) (err error) { data, ok := dbValue.([]byte) if !ok { return nil } *ufb = make([]bool, len(data)*8) for i, b := range data { for j := 0; j < 8; j++ { (*ufb)[i*8+j] = (b>>j)&1 == 1 } } return nil } func (ufb UploadingFileBlocks) Value(ctx context.Context, field *schema.Field, dbValue reflect.Value) (value interface{}, err error) { data := make([]byte, (len(ufb)+7)/8) for i, b := range ufb { if b { data[i/8] |= 1 << (i % 8) } } return data, nil } type UploadingFileView struct { ID uint `json:"id"` Filename string `json:"filename"` Description string `json:"description"` TotalSize int64 `json:"totalSize"` BlockSize int64 `json:"blockSize"` BlocksCount int `json:"blocksCount"` StorageID uint `json:"storageId"` ResourceID uint `json:"resourceId"` } func (uf *UploadingFile) ToView() *UploadingFileView { return &UploadingFileView{ ID: uf.ID, Filename: uf.Filename, Description: uf.Description, TotalSize: uf.TotalSize, BlockSize: uf.BlockSize, BlocksCount: uf.BlocksCount(), StorageID: uf.TargetStorageID, ResourceID: uf.TargetResourceID, } }
